It will be a match that will be remembered more for individual performances rather RCB beating MI by a whopping 54 runs to stay at the 3rd spot on the IPL points table.

Batting first, RCB scored 165/6 courtesy a half century each by Virat Kohli and Glenn Maxwell. Chasing which, openers took Mumbai off to a decent start with a 57-run start. But post that, the batting collapsed. Harshal Patel continued his fine form and claimed 4 wickets which included a hat-trick. He is now the 3rd RCB player to claim 3 wickets on 3 consecutive deliveries. It meant that Mumbai were bowled out for mere 111, their lowest score vs RCB.

Kohli's men finally ended a 2-match losing run and remained on the 3rd spot. Mumbai on the other hand choked again and slipper down to the 7th position with 3rd consecutive defeat.
